The zeroeth auxiliary view is the base view it void +dev_section(gf, pf) : add geometry and ports for rendering +char *gf; : geometry file name +char *pf; : portal file name(s) + +Add the given geometry file to the list of geometry to render for +intermediate views if direct geometry rendering is available. The +second argument gives the name(s) of any portal geometry files +associated with this section. Multiple portal file names are separated +by spaces. A single octree file will be given for the geometry, ending +in the ".oct" suffix. Portal files will be given as zero or more +Radiance scene description file names. If no portals are given for +this section, the string may be NULL. The character strings are +guaranteed to be static (or permanently allocated) such that they may +be safely stored as a pointer. The same pointers or file lists may be +(and often are) given repeatedly. If a given geometry file does not +exist, the call should be silently ignored. If gf is NULL, then the +last section has been given, and the display can be updated with the +new information. + + +void dev_close() : close the display Close the display device and free up resources in preparation for exit. @@ -135,3 +164,5 @@ Set odev.v.type=0 and odev.hres=odev.vres=0 when done. extern VIEW *dev_auxview(); + +extern int2 *beam_view();
